Transaction 67cacf61ea254638054faf52bfb47a7a3f00efdc2d1909f47706048e98fe563a
1 Input
2 Outputs
- 67cacf61ea254638054faf52bfb47a7a3f00efdc2d1909f47706048e98fe563a:0
- 67cacf61ea254638054faf52bfb47a7a3f00efdc2d1909f47706048e98fe563a:1
value 40915828
address 1BnBzhFbSmsKs1oV4m4kWjr3BKjPa9C1So
value 500000000
address 18zZejYZuEJbV4aRNmBpW9tyM7FYzFUM7f